> Why do we capture only when we migrate MIGRATE_MOVABLE type?
> If you have a reasone, it should have been added as comment.
> 

Good question and there is an answer. However, I also spotted a problem when
thinking about this more where !MIGRATE_MOVABLE allocations are forced to
do a full compaction. The simple solution would be to only set cc->page for
MIGRATE_MOVABLE but there is a better approach that I've implemented in the
patch below. It includes a comment that should answer your question. Does
this make sense to you?

+       /*
+        * For MIGRATE_MOVABLE allocations we capture a suitable page ASAP
+        * regardless of the migratetype of the freelist is is captured from.
+        * This is fine because the order for a high-order MIGRATE_MOVABLE
+        * allocation is typically at least a pageblock size and overall
+        * fragmentation is not impaired. Other allocation types must
+        * capture pages from their own migratelist because otherwise they
+        * could pollute other pageblocks like MIGRATE_MOVABLE with
+        * difficult to move pages and making fragmentation worse overall.
+        */
